Decoding the Designation: "7628"
"7628": This is a style number, an industry-standard code that defines the specific construction of the woven fabric.
It specifies the yarn type (e.g., filament count and twist), the thread count (ends per inch in warp and weft), and the resulting thickness and weight.
A style 7628 fabric is characterized by its heavy weight and thick build.
"E Glass": Denotes the glass composition. "E" stands for Electrical, meaning it is made from the standard alumino-borosilicate glass formulation optimized for excellent electrical insulation.
"Electronic Fiberglass Fabric": Confirms its primary application is for the electronics industry, specifically as a reinforcement for PCBs.
Key Properties and Specifications
A typical 7628 E-glass fabric has the following characteristics:
Areal Weight: Approximately 200 - 210 grams per square meter (g/m²). This makes it one of the heaviest standard fabrics.
Thickness: Approximately 0.185 - 0.200 mm (or 7.3 - 7.9 mils).
Weave Style: A plain weave, which provides good stability and low yarn slippage.
Thread Count: Typically around 17x12 (17 warp yarns and 12 weft yarns per inch).
Key Properties:
High Mechanical Strength: Its thick, heavy construction provides exceptional rigidity and dimensional stability to the final PCB laminate.
Good Electrical Insulation: Inherits the excellent dielectric properties of E-glass.
Controlled Dielectric Constant (Dk): While not a "low-loss" material like 2116 or 3814+, its electrical properties are stable and predictable for many applications.
Thermal & Chemical Resistance: Withstands PCB manufacturing processes like soldering and exposure to chemicals.
